Despicable Me 4 is set to hit theaters in 2024, with a focus on the story of supervillain-turned-League agent Gru. The film is helmed by Chris Renaud and produced by Illumination. The latest film has come up with a creative promo video featuring the NBA star Nikola Jokić. In the hilarious promo, Jokić confides to his therapist how he made some of the craziest fans just by dressing up like Gru from Despicable Me.
Steve Carell returns to voice the long-nosed character in the film, while Will Ferrell voices the supervillain Maxime Le Mal who seeks revenge on Gru. The film is the fourth main installment and the sixth installment overall in the franchise.
Nikola Jokić’s Promo For Despicable Me 4 Turns Out To Be Just Perfect
Despicable Me 4 has brought in Nikola Jokić for a hilarious promo. In the promo video, Jokić is seen attending therapy for the one time he accidentally wore an outfit that made him look like Gru from the Despicable Me film series. He revealed that the outfit won him some new ardent fans who are willing to go the extreme mile for him. He shows to his therapist on a screen that he’s being followed by a bunch of Minions.

According to NBA.com, the Denver Nuggets star arrived at the first-round playoff night between the Nuggets and Lakers dressed as Gru on Saturday night. The NBA MVP star wore a black jacket and a striped scarf wrapped around his neck. Jokić is providing incredibly fun promotional content for both the new film and the playoffs.
What Is Despicable Me 4 About?
Illumination’s new film looks to ride upon the billion-dollar success of the 2022 film, Minions: The Rise of Gru. Steve Carell and Kristen Wiig return as Gru and Lucy alongside Miranda Cosgrove, Dana Grier, and Madison Polan playing their daughters Margo, Edith, and Agnes respectively. The family also welcomes a new member, Gru Jr., in the fourth film.
According to the synopsis of the film, Carell’s Gru faces a new enemy in Maxime Le Mal, played by Will Ferrell, who seeks revenge against Gru and his family. The supervillain is assisted by his femme fatale girlfriend Valentina, voiced by Griselda star Sofia Vergara. White Lotus creator Mike White joined the Despicable Me films’ veteran writer Ken Daurio to pen the screenplay for the film.
Chris Meledandri, CEO of Illumination, and Brett Hoffman will serve as the producers, while Patrick Delage is a co-director with Chris Renaud in the film.
Despicable Me 4 will be released on July 3, 2024.
